Output 058a0eb3019e805265653815f2138627bf17fc0b5f920d7a9e73b621dc27d4e3:1

value
258900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c928b9149e61b5223e7f05f07a4ff7b2d04a72 OP_EQUAL
address
MUksGwmJmK3hGyBq61LjoMBeDykSwy663z
transaction
058a0eb3019e805265653815f2138627bf17fc0b5f920d7a9e73b621dc27d4e3
spent
true